Background
The multi-way reversing valve is a combined valve with two or more reversing valves as main bodies. The reversing valve is a valve which changes the on-off relationship of an oil duct connected to a valve body by means of the relative movement between a valve core and the valve body. According to different working requirements, auxiliary valves such as a safety overflow valve, a one-way valve, an oil replenishing valve and the like can be combined. The multi-way reversing valve in the market at present has smaller flow capacity, can not improve output flow, and has poorer adaptability.

Detailed Description
The following describes embodiments of the present invention with reference to the drawings.
As shown in fig. 1-2, the novel high-pressure large-flow multi-way reversing valve comprises an oil inlet valve 1 and an oil return valve 2, wherein a plurality of reversing valves 3 are arranged between the oil inlet valve 1 and the oil return valve 2, connecting holes are formed in the valve bodies of the oil inlet valve 1, the reversing valves 3 and the oil return valve 2, the connecting holes are fastened by matching with nuts 5 through bolts 4 to connect the oil inlet valve 1, the reversing valves 3 and the oil return valve 2 into a whole, a safety valve 6 is installed at one end of the oil inlet valve 1, the adjacent oil inlet valve 1, reversing valve 3 and oil return valve 2 are connected through oil ducts, a confluence valve 7 is further arranged between the two reversing valves 3, an auxiliary oil inlet 8 is formed in the confluence valve 7, and the confluence valve 7 is connected with an oil outlet of the left reversing valve 3 through a one-way valve 9.
Two ends of the reversing valve 3 are provided with end covers 10, and the end covers 10 are provided with electromagnetic valves 11. A three-position six-way valve is arranged in the reversing valve 3. The joints of the oil inlet valve 1, the oil return valve 2 and the reversing valve 3 are sealed by rectangular sealing rings 12. The check valve 9 consists of a spring seat 13, a spring 14 and a valve 15, the valve 15 is nested in the spring seat 13, and the spring 14 is installed on the spring seat 13.
The utility model has the advantages of the ability of overflowing is great, maintain easy maintenance, the rigidity and the intensity of valve body are higher. When the output flow is not enough, the extra oil supply pump of accessible is supplementary oil inlet fuel feeding to improve the output flow of work hydraulic fluid port, satisfy different mechanisms to different flow demands.
